Karen Willis

Karen Willis, passed away on April 28, 2023, in Norfolk General Hospital from complications resulting from a car accident. Karen was a Corolla resident.  Born on December 26, 1955, Karen was the daughter of Gayle (Kane) Grinstead and VADM Eugene A. Grinstead, both North Carolina natives.

Karen is survived by her husband, Jim Willis, and her two cats, Norman and Cheetah. She is also survived by siblings Kathy Lederer, Mark Grinstead, Robert Grinstead, Michele Arkwright and John Grinstead, as well as many n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her brothers, Andrew Grinstead, Kurt Grinstead and Mathew Grinstead.

Karen was a dedicated wife and deeply loved her family (and her cats!).  She was a nature and travel enthusiast and spent many years as an avid SCUBA diver.  She was also a world traveler.  She lived in France for nearly a decade, and traveled widely throughout the Caribbean, Europe, Asia, Africa, Australia, South America and the United States. She spent many years as the primary caregiver for her mother, and for her brother Mathew, for which her family will be forever grateful.

Charity was an important part of Karen’s life, and she donated generously to local, national and international causes, including by creating a scholarship in her mother’s name here in the outer banks.  Her legacy will continue through the Karen Willis Memorial Scholarship established through the Outer Banks Community Foundation.

She will be deeply missed by her family and friends.
